There are a couple of things that you can anticipate with lipo operation. One of these is that the surgeon will go through your medical history and check your general wellbeing. After he or she will mark the sections of your body that are to experience lipo. Some anesthesia will soon be given to you to numb the regions. Depending on the quantity of fat you need to remove, the procedure may take several hours. Later you may experience some pain and swelling that will go down after a few days. On the day of the scheduled operation in Spokane your surgeon will indicate the parts of the body that you desire fat removed. Afterwards he or she will give you anesthesia to numb the region. Local anesthesia is an option most doctors go for because it will only numb the area which will be operated on. Along with anesthesia the doctor will insert epinephrine, that will help in reduce excessive bleeding. The surgeon may continue injecting fluid until the skin is very solid. The surgeon will go ahead to make an incision into the area and insert a cannula that is a hollow tube that will be used to suction out the fat. The liquid and fat that's removed will be inserted into a flask which the surgeon will probably be tracking to note the total amount of fluid and fat that's removed. As you are losing fluid during the procedure, you will be given more fluid intravenously as a replacement. |
